New Orleans Bakery is selling Toilet Paper Cakes During the Coronavirus Epidemic

With #toiletpaperapocalypse trending, this isn’t a cure for the virus, but cake is definitely good for the soul

Evidently, a bakery in the New Orleans area is selling customers cakes in shaped like rolls of toilet paper. TP has become hard to find during the coronavirus pandemic.

"We have some toilet paper cakes in the bakery today! Swing on buy and grab a TP cake and your favorite bakery treats! To-go only. 😋" tweeted Haydels bakery.

“It’s just anytime something in the city happens, we’ve garnered the reputation for making light of bad situations,” co-owner David Haydel told the Times-Picayune. “We made a couple of them as a joke a couple of days ago and they sold immediately. Then 10 more were snapped up the next day.”

The bakery has closed for two weeks. But not to fear, you may still purchase their confections online.

“Haydel’s Bakery has been through many trials and tribulations over the past 61 years. We survived Hurricanes Betsy and Katrina. We will survive this virus as well,” they wrote on Facebook.
